Considering the fact that Dyson launched its initial hair dryer, the Supersonic, in 2016 it has been keen to disrupt the hair care category and when it announced a $500 million expenditure to boost hair care tech, it set its cash wherever its intentions were being. This calendar year, it created superior on that assure with what may be its most groundbreaking solution nonetheless, the Airstrait, a flat iron that dries and straightens soaked hair without any hot plates. Rather of extreme heat, it takes advantage of specific airflow to easy hair, as a result of slots that distribute air at a forty five diploma angle.

The Estée Lauder Cos. improved its stake in Deciem, the dad or mum enterprise on the Regular, to 76 per cent in May perhaps, having an agreement to buy the remaining 24 % immediately after a three-yr time period at a purchase value that may be based on Deciem’s sales. The Might transaction valued the business at $two.2 billion, which makes it the biggest offer in Lauder’s record. Be that as it may — the model of attaining a small stake in an explosive brand name, then scaling up financial commitment is one which Lauder has perfected.

Burberry’s newest Women of all ages’s scent, Goddess, promptly entered the pantheon of profits when it launched in August. The scent, created less than license by Coty, shot to the very best of Status fragrance rankings and led the calendar year’s essential olfactive trend — the resurgence of vanilla — that has a trio of notes which include Firgood, often known as vanilla caviar, employed for The very first time within a fragrance. Goddess was also right on focus on culturally, tapping into the massive results of Barbie with brand name ambassador Emma Mackey for a marketing campaign photographed by Mario Sorrenti.
